> There are two interesting research topics that I would like discus, but I
> am not sure if they are within the scope of this IAB program. Both topics
> are related to *Quantum Computing*.
>
>
>
> *1) Looking into the energy efficiency of quantum computing* is
> an interesting topic for *quantum Internet* research.  For example, there
> is *Quantum Energy Initiative (QEI) *[
> https://quantum-energy-initiative.org/
> <https://www.google.com/url?q=https://www.google.com/url?q%3Dhttps://quantum-energy-initiative.org/%26source%3Dgmail-imap%26ust%3D1693553272000000%26usg%3DAOvVaw2iYVQfF7Chd2JvJnUeZwrv&source=gmail-imap&ust=1693586807000000&usg=AOvVaw1joRVHoVa9KTsb6CO45amp>]
> which provides a "*path towards energy-efficient, sustainable quantum
> technologies, and to possibly bring out an energetic quantum advantage." *

> "*With its head-spinning size and connections, the power system is so
> complex that even supercomputers struggle to efficiently solve certain
> optimization problems.** But quantum computers might fare better, and now
> researchers can explore that prospect thanks to a software interface
> between quantum computers and grid equipment.*
>
> *The link from quantum to grid—achieved by a team from the National
> Renewable Energy Laboratory (NREL) with funding from the Department of
> Energy Office of Energy Efficiency and Renewable Energy, and in
> collaboration with RTDS Technologies Inc., and Atom Computing—allows
> researchers to perform “quantum-in-the-loop” experiments. And this
> capability goes beyond just energy devices: With NREL’s Advanced Research
> on Integrated Energy Systems (ARIES)
> <https://www.google.com/url?q=https://www.google.com/url?q%3Dhttps://www.nrel.gov/aries/index.html%26source%3Dgmail-imap%26ust%3D1693553272000000%26usg%3DAOvVaw1j92_vg7jUZJYryM28hvA8&source=gmail-imap&ust=1693586807000000&usg=AOvVaw1Tyq8WmUoQhBi_cZ_WfTg0>,
> researchers can run quantum in-the-loop within highly realistic power
> systems. Quantum in-the-loop could be an important next step for using
> quantum computing to optimize electric grid operations with the
> interconnection of increasingly complex distributed energy resources*."
> You can find more details in this paper
> https://ieeexplore.ieee.org/document/10108354
> <https://www.google.com/url?q=https://www.google.com/url?q%3Dhttps://ieeexplore.ieee.org/document/10108354%26source%3Dgmail-imap%26ust%3D1693553272000000%26usg%3DAOvVaw2quQTwKLo04wl6-IsntBXT&source=gmail-imap&ust=1693586807000000&usg=AOvVaw17wELnMfVyRKLkUESDmehB>.
> Using Quantum Computing the same way can help optimize the energy usage of
> the Internet. For example it can be used to calculate the schedule for
> Internert routers as described in tvr.

> Program Description:
>
> The E-Impact Program is a venue for discussing environmental impacts
> and sustainability of Internet technology. Within this scope, the
> program looks at trends, issues, improvement opportunities, ideas, best
> practices, and subsequent direction of work related to Internet
> technology, architecture, and operations, including visibility and
> efficiency on energy and other environmentally-impacting attributes. In
> particular, the group focuses on Internet architecture's role in these
> topics.
>
> The program targets topics not yet progressed into concrete standards
> or research efforts in the IETF or IRTF while also being a coordination
> point for work across multiple WGs/RGs, and a venue to highlight
> ongoing work in the IETF/IRTF as well as external SDOs. The program
> will use the existing E-Impact mailing list [2] as the venue for
> discussions.
>
> The program's progress and the quality of discussion may point to the
> need to organize additional workshop(s) to continue the 2022 IAB
> workshop on the Environmental Impact of Internet Applications and
> Systems [1].
>
> The program may work on documents that analyze areas where Internet
> technology faces challenges related to the program's topics or provide
> architectural guidance. Potential examples of such documents include
> ones that describe sustainable network architectures, and those that
> document tradeoffs between environmental impacts and other
> characteristics such as performance and availability. Publishing any
> document as an RFC will be at the discretion of the IAB.
>
> The program intends to have regular virtual meetings along with
> periodic hybrid meetings that are co-located with in-person IETF
> meetings. The program is open to all interested participants, and its
> meetings will be publicly announced.
